At least don't do it until you're towards the end of your character. I learned the hard way that doing the Civil War quest early on has disastrous implications in terms of breaking other quests. For instance, if you join the Companions after the Civil War and they give you the Hired Muscle quest, you're screwed. The reason is because the guy you have to intimidate lived in one of the houses that got destroyed and he no longer exists. Therefore you can't play the Companions quest line.
